Halloween as a text


October 31st is counted down by hundreds of kids readying to go from house to house to get a teat or give a trick. Halloween is seen is so many different ways for many people, for some strong christen believers Halloween is thought to be a holiday that celebrates the devil. Many christen believers also look at Halloween not how it sounds but as all hollows Eva. Then for others Halloween is time to think to celebrate all the souls that have left the world and are not with us any more. Halloween can be looked at in so many ways from being a fun holiday to being the most evil. When looking back into history around Ireland it shows why we some of the things we do today the trick or treating or dressing up in different ways. A long time ago the people of Ireland would dress up to draw the evil spirits away from their towns today we dress up to change the way people look at us. For example when you go to a hunted house you know the monsters are just people dressed up but its still scares you. Also along time ago kids would go from door to door to get wood for their fire today we do this but we get candy. All the thing we do today go back to the beliefs and the traditions they did hunderds of years ago.
